Georgia - Import of Single Yarn Containing 85 % or More by Weight of Acrylic or Modacrylic Staple Fibres

Since 2014, Georgia Import of Single Yarn Containing 85% or More by Weight of Acrylic or Modacrylic Staple Fibres increased 492.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 76 among other countries in Import of Single Yarn Containing 85% or More by Weight of Acrylic or Modacrylic Staple Fibres with $22,995.12. Georgia is overtaken by Kyrgyzstan, which was number 75 at $23,543 and is followed by Switzerland with $18,084. Bangladesh lead the ranking with $70,735,863.43 in 2019, a growth of 2.2% versus 2018. Italy, Morocco and Portugal resp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Georgia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+492.9% per year, while Finland recorded the worst performance at -84% per year.
